Buatlah fungsi untuk mencari turunan ke-k (ordo=k) dari fungsi X pangkat 9 # Membuat Fungsi
Turunan <- function(k) {
# Fungsi asli: f(x) = x^9
n <- 9
# Validasi input
if (k < 0) {
warning("Ordo turunan harus bilangan bulat >= 0.")
return(NULL)
}
if (k > n) {
return(0) # Turunan ke-k dari x^9 untuk k > 9 adalah 0
}
# Hitung koefisien turunan
koefisien <- factorial(n) / factorial(n - k)
# Eksponen baru setelah diturunkan
eksponen_baru <- n - k
# Return bentuk fungsinya (dalam bentuk ekspresi)
hasil <- paste0(koefisien, "*x^", eksponen_baru)
return(hasil)
}
Turunan(3)
## [1] "504*x^6"